The Packer position requires an individual to be detail oriented and flexible. The individual will not only be responsible for packing units but be available to assist in any other areas in the plant as needed, including cementing, shipping, testing, etc. Essential Duties and Responsibilities
- Knowledge on how to use and read a tape measure is required.
- Must be able to read work drawings and understand written instruction manuals & standard practice manuals.
- Responsible for rigging a unit and attaching various parts to it such as aspirator, intake valves, cylinders, lines, cords, anchors, locator lights and batteries.
- Will need to tie various knots in a specific manner.
- Soapstone (dust) specific areas of unit so that no sticking occurs.
- Deflate unit to prepare it for folding.
- Follow standard procedure for folding the unit utilizing a diagram and written instructions.
- Using the hands and feet, must be able to; push, pull, tug, bend, kneel, stoop, etc. to get unit in its case during a folding process.
- Must lace cases up
